AI Architect Jobs in Washington

AI Architect jobs in Washington are among the most active in the country, concentrated in cloud computing, enterprise software, aerospace, and defense sectors with demand at every level from associate to principal architect. Seattle, Bellevue, and Redmond anchor the hiring market, where Microsoft, Amazon, and Boeing maintain large AI and machine learning engineering teams. What Washington Employers Look For

The qualifications that appear most often in AI architect jobs across Washington.

  • Bachelor's or master's degree in computer science, machine learning, or a related engineering field
  • Demonstrated experience designing and deploying large-scale AI or machine learning systems in production
  • Proficiency with cloud AI platforms such as Azure, AWS, or Google Cloud and their ML services
  • Hands-on expertise with frameworks including PyTorch, TensorFlow, or JAX for model development
  • Experience leading cross-functional teams and translating business requirements into AI architecture decisions
  • Familiarity with MLOps practices including model monitoring, CI/CD pipelines, and data governance standards

AI Architect Jobs in Washington: Frequently Asked Questions

How do you become a ai architect in Washington?

Washington does not require a state-issued license to work as an ai architect, so the path runs through education and demonstrated technical experience. Most hiring managers expect at least a bachelor's degree in computer science, data science, or a related field, with a master's degree common at senior levels. Building a portfolio of production AI systems, contributing to open-source projects, and earning cloud certifications recognized by Washington's major tech employers strengthens a candidacy considerably.

How much do AI architects make in Washington?

AI architects in Washington earn a median of about $128,940 a year, based on May 2025 Bureau of Labor Statistics wage data, ranging from around $60,210 for the lowest 10% to over $200,610 for the top 10%. Pay rises with experience, specialty, and employer.

Which Washington cities have the most ai architect jobs?

Seattle, Bellevue, and Redmond are the Washington cities with the most ai architect openings. Seattle and Bellevue dominate because Microsoft, Amazon, and a wide ecosystem of enterprise software and cloud companies are headquartered or have major engineering hubs there, while Redmond's concentration of Microsoft campuses and partner firms sustains consistent demand even outside the core Seattle metro.

Are there remote ai architect jobs in Washington?

Yes, and more than most fields. About 73% of ai architect openings tied to Washington are remote or hybrid as of September 2026, reflecting how much of the work involves design, code review, and stakeholder collaboration rather than on-site hardware. Fully remote roles tend to cluster in platform architecture and research positions, while roles involving on-premises infrastructure or regulated defense contracts typically require a physical presence in the Puget Sound area.

How can I get hired as a ai architect in Washington with little or no experience?

The most realistic entry path is through a machine learning engineer or data engineer role, then moving into architecture responsibilities as you take ownership of system design decisions. Microsoft and Amazon both run university recruiting and new-grad programs in the Seattle area that place candidates into AI platform teams with structured mentorship. Building a GitHub portfolio of deployed ML projects and earning an Azure or AWS machine learning specialty certification gives candidates without a long resume a concrete credential Washington hiring managers recognize.
